> It is possible to edit entered value in non editing mode. To achieve this 
> enter some value to input and then type some another keys and again press 
> enter. The input will be changed. But during second editing of input the 
> input is not in editing state but in the submitted state. 
> It will be nice to switch input to editing state whenever it is edited. 
> This behavior is noticeable both on 4.0.0.Final and on 4.1.0.20110805-M1 
> showcase app, and on all browsers.
